Ticket: Drift in nightly reindex config

Heads up — the nightly search reindex on Quillsearch has drifted again. Prod box reindex-02 is running with different batch sizes and a shorter lock timeout than what's in the repo, probably from someone's hotfix back in March that never got committed. Reindex finishes fine but takes ~40 min longer than it should. For the record, here's what the box is actually running with right now.

service settings:
novath:
  pin: 1396
  tenant: pelys
  seal: seal_ccc035e1
  metrics_host: metrics.novath.qorvelworks.test
  standby_team: fraeth
  escalation: drueth-zorok
  nonce: 61d508

## Runbook — Graphlign Release

Graphlign renders dependency graphs for plugin ecosystems; this fragment covers cutting a plugin-facing release. Tag the commit, run `graphlign pack`, and confirm the schema version matches the published API tier. Plugins built against mismatched tiers fail to load — no exceptions. Upload the bundle to the registry staging channel and request promotion. The registry verifies every upload against our release signature. Verification requires the key that follows.

rollout seal: bky4_DFM9

**Onboarding: Cold Starts on Quenlet Handlers**

Quenlet serverless handlers idle out after eight minutes; the next invocation pays a cold-start penalty while dependencies load and the env file is re-read. If p99 latency alerts fire overnight, check the warmer schedule first. The handler also needs its signing secret at init, set on the line below.

sealed setting: RELAY_SECRET5=82864